Job Summary:
We are looking for a skilled and detail-oriented UTM Supervisor for project-based vessel attendance assignments in the Marine / Offshore / Shipyard domain.
Key Responsibilities:
Conduct Ultrasonic Thickness Measurement (UTM) inspections onboard vessels.
Carry out steel renewal assessments, gauging, and corrosion estimation across
various vessel areas.
Inspect and assess structural components including cargo holds, ballast tanks, deck
outfitting, pipelines, and engine room areas.
Prepare accurate inspection reports and provide technical support as required.
Ensure all work is carried out in compliance with vessel working hours and safety
regulations.
Required Qualifications & Skills:
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ering is preferred.
Hands-on experience in UTM / UT inspections on vessels, offshore structures, or
shipyard projects.
Familiarity with marine vessel structures and components.
Solid reporting and documentation skills.
Ability to work onboard vessels and adapt to site conditions.
Valid documents required: NDT Level II, Passport, CDC (Continuous Discharge
Certificate)
